Installing sod or having overseeding done in spring is ideal. Your new grass will have ample time to establish before the intense heat of a Georgia summer sets in. Both sod and overseeding can help fix problem areas – or give you a complete makeover – but they each come with their own pros and cons. Keep reading to learn about the benefits and drawbacks so you can make an informed decision when it’s time to rejuvenate your yard!

As you wind down your yard care for the year, it’s important to remember the larger ornamental plants. Your trees and shrubs are tough, but they need help if they’re to make it through the winter unscathed. Late fall is the time to give them the nourishment and protection they need. Here’s what your late fall tree care plan should entail.
